The Manufacturing sector sales reached RM1.9 trillion; surged by 4.6 per cent in 2024
The sales value of the Manufacturing sector in 2024 reached RM1.9 trillion, surged 4.6 per cent (2023: 0.2%), while the sales in December 2024 amounted to RM158.4 billion (5.7%). The growth of sales value in the Manufacturing sector was primarily supported by the Food, beverages & tobacco sub-sector which remained to record double-digit growth at 14.6 per cent in December 2024 (November 2024: 12.3%). Meanwhile, the Electrical & electronics products and Non-metallic mineral products, basic metal & fabricated metal products sub-sectors also made contributions to the Manufacturing sector’s sales growth, registered increases of 8.7 per cent (November 2024: 8.6%) and 3.2 per cent (November 2024: 2.7%), respectively. Comparison with the preceding month, the sales value shrank by 2.2 per cent as against RM162.0 billion recorded in November 2024.
The sales value of export-oriented industries which representing 70.1 per cent of total sales further expanded to 7.1 per cent in December 2024 (November 2024: 6.1%). The expansion was predominantly attributable to the increase in the Manufacture of computer, electronics & optical products at 9.4 per cent; followed by Manufacture of vegetable & animal oils & fats (17.0%); and Manufacture of rubber products (10.7%) industries.
The domestic-oriented industries also improved by 2.5 per cent in December 2024 after registered 0.8 per cent increase in November 2024. The increase was mainly contributed by a rise in the Manufacture of food processing products which soared to 11.2 per cent (November 2024: 8.7%); Manufacture of fabricated metal products industry except machinery & equipment (4.8%); and the Manufacture of beverages (16.3%) industries. On a month-on-month basis, both export and domestic-oriented industries dropped by 3.0 per cent and 0.3 per cent, respectively.
There are 2.40 million persons engaged in this sector during December 2024, continued to rise at 1.0 per cent for two consecutive months. The addition was mainly driven by the Food, beverages & tobacco (2.3%); Non-metallic mineral products, basic metal & fabricated metal products (1.3%); and Wood, furniture, paper products & printing (0.9%) sub-sectors. On a month-on-month basis, the number of employees in this sector declined 0.1 per cent.
The salaries & wages paid in the Manufacturing sector also posted an increase of 1.7 per cent, amounted to RM8.9 billion in December 2024. Comparison by month-on-month, the salaries & wages paid increased by 7.1 per cent. Subsequently, the sales value per employee went up to RM66,027 (4.6%), while the average salaries & wages per employee in December 2024 was RM3,706, rose by 0.6 per cent year-on-year.
In the fourth quarter of 2024, the sales value in the Manufacturing sector grew by 4.4 per cent year-on-year, achieved RM481.8 billion (Q3 2024: RM483.2 billion, 6.5%). The rise was supported by the Food, beverages & tobacco (12.7%); Electrical & Electronics Products (6.8%); and Wood, furniture, paper products & printing (2.0%) sub-sectors. Meanwhile, the number of employees during the quarter improved to 1.0 per cent (Q3 2024: 0.8%), while salaries & wages paid remained at 1.7 per cent.
